So the Mobo i am looking at has no USB 3.0 header, but it has plenty of USB 2.0. How badly would the speed be effected if I were to  buy an USB 3.0 to 2.0 header, would it be worth it, or should I get a new mobo? I have a Case with a front usb 3.0 and i want to use it.

Do you have any USB 3.0 device? What kind of USB 3.0 devices do you have?

I think it only depends on how often do you use USB 3.0 devices, then you could consider to buy a PCI USB3.0 expansion card for your current motherboard, a whole new motheboard or only an USB 3.0 to 2.0 adapter...
